Abstract
- Summary: This study reports the length‐weight relationships (LWRs) of <italic>Acrossocheilus beijiangensis</italic> Wu & Lin, 1977 and <italic>Barbodes semifasciolatus</italic> (Günther, 1868) from the upper reaches of Beijiang River, Guangdong Province, China. Sample sizes for the two fish species were 335 for <italic>A. beijiangensis</italic> and 106 for <italic>B. semifasciolatus</italic>. Fishes were collected on a monthly basis between November 2013 and December 2014 using gill nets (30 m long × 1.2 m high, mesh‐size 1.5 cm) and fish cages (mesh‐size 0.5 cm). LWRs were established as W = 0.0052L3.3249 (<italic>r</italic>2 = .9696) for <italic>A. beijiangensis</italic> and W = 0.0088L3.2405 (<italic>r</italic>2 = .9469) for <italic>B. semifasciolatus</italic>. No previous information is available on LWRs for these two species in FishBase.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
